  • Patent number: 11040373
    Abstract: A sliding drawer sifter apparatus for sorting plant buds by size includes a frame having a set of drawers comprising a top drawer, a middle drawer, and a bottom draw. Each of the set of drawers has a handle and an inner lip. A set of sifter grates each has a grate perimeter selectively engageable with the inner lip of each of the drawers and a grate body coupled within the grate perimeter. The set of sifter grates comprises a top grate, a middle grate, and a bottom grate. The grate body of the bottom grate is finer than the grate body of the middle grate. The grate body of the middle grate is finer than the grate body of the top grate. The top grate, the middle grate, and the bottom grate are configured to sort progressively smaller plant buds into the set of drawers.

  • Patent number: 4958935
    Abstract: A method of breaking up bundles of adherent hard fibers, particularly steelfibers and feeding the obtained single fibers to a mixing device. The method comprises vibrating said bundles of adhering fibers on an oscillating screen to obtain separated fibers, passing said separated fibers being aligned in a plane parallel to the plane of said screen through oblong openings of said screen, through which openings in the main only one fiber at a time can pass and supplying by means of gravity and oscillating force said individual fibers to said mixing device spread over a large area, said area being larger than the area of said screen. The screen (4) has oblong openings (8) having a length corresponding mainly to the length of the fibers and a width being essentially less than the length of said fibers.

  • Patent number: 4233151
    Abstract: A stack of interfitting sieve trays are held in position on a carrier by an upstanding periperial wall on the carrier which engages the lower portion of the lower sieve tray, and by a plurality of clamp-down units which at their lower ends are pivotally connected to end portions of the carrier and at their upper ends include a lever operated hook mechanisms for engaging upper edge portions of the top sieve tray. Side edge portions of the carrier are provided with upper and lower bearing strips. These edge portions are received between upper and lower sets of cam rollers which are mounted onto web portions of side members which have been fashioned from channel stock. The side members carry bearing strips which contact and guide the side edges of the carrier. The clamp-down units are overweighted on their outer sides so that when released they will fall outwardly against stop means for limiting the amount of outward movement.
